我想为我的三层甜甜圈图中的每个标签和层添加百分比值。 下面的代码适当地生成了三层甜甜圈图和图例。但是,它会扰乱百分比值的显示(请参阅此问题底部的输出图)。 目前在堆栈溢出或其他地方的解决方案只适用于将百分比值添加到饼图/圆环图(例如:How do I use matplotlib autopct? ),但我的饼图/圆环图有三个层/级别。我的代码如下: import matplotlib.pyplot as plt
import numpy as np
fig = plt.figure()
fig.set_figheight(7)
fig.set_figwidth(22)
ax1 = fi
在圆环图中,应像这样自定义百分比值 This is my doughnut chart look like this 有没有办法在ng2图表中做到这一点? 下面是我使用的代码 public barChartType: ChartType = 'doughnut';
public barChartData: ChartDataSets[] = [
{ data: [20,20,30] }
];
public barChartOptions: ChartOptions = {
responsive: false,
maintainAspect
我正在使用谷歌饼图,但在修改它时遇到问题。经过多次复杂的计算,我得到了一个百分比值,比如说67%。我希望在饼图/圆环图中显示单个百分比值。
我的HTML代码是
<div id="chart_div"></div>
我的Javascript代码是
function drawChart() {
var data = google.visualization.arrayToDataTable([
['Category', 'Value'],
['Foo', 67]
]);
var chart =
我试图获得一个基本的THREE.js示例,从那里开始工作并修改它,但是它只是不断地输出一个圆环,不管我改变了什么。
我将文档页面中的确切代码复制到一个JSFiddle中,然后再一次得到一个圆环。
下面是docs页面示例:
下面是对圆环的摆弄:
我尝试将代码从docs页面添加到示例中,如下所示:
var geometry = new THREE.CylinderGeometry( 5, 5, 20, 32 );
var material = new THREE.MeshPhongMaterial(
{
color: 0x156289,
emissive: 0x072534,
我发现d3js甜甜圈图表非常适合我的需求。对我来说唯一的问题是它不支持IE8。
有没有办法在IE8中使用d3js圆环图?
SCRIPT438: Object doesn't support property or method 'map'
d3.v3.min.js, line 3 character 17383
我知道d3js只支持IE8+浏览器。我想知道是否只有这种情况下才有解决方法。如果没有,你能用相同的许可协议(BSD)重新发布一个js库吗?
当我不知道如何添加时,我试图在我的angular app.But中使用angular.morris-chart.js绘制一些圆环图。
我将js文件添加到我的libs目录中,并在调用angular后将其添加到我的index.html中。我还把它注入到我的应用程序中。
但它仍然不起作用。我在我的浏览器控制台中得到了这个错误:'ReferenceError: Morris is not defined‘。
有什么线索可以解决我的问题吗?